I think per-prefix granularity is still possible.
Advertising a SRGB for a particular algorithm does not mean that all the 
prefixes advertised will be advertised for that particular algorithm.

I mean considering you have a network with node A ,B, C, D, each one 
advertising a loopback.
You want to run algo 0 between all routers, so each router advertises a SRGB 
for algo 0, and loopback address with SID is advertised with Algo 0 also.
Now you want to run algo 2 but only A and B requires communication between each 
other using algo 2. As C and D may be on the path from A to B, all routers 
requires supports of algo 2 and a new SRGB is provisioned on all routers 
corresponding to algo 2. But in term of SID advertisement, you may configure 
only A and B to advertise Algo2 for Loopback address (Algo is encoded in 
PrefixSID), so there would be only 2 new MPLS forwarding entries instead of 4.

A possible limitation of advertizing per-alg SRGB is that a node will always 
assign/maintain as many SRGB-alg labels (on possibly all nodes) for a prefix 
without being able to control this on per-prefix if needed.
Are there are any considerations for this in your proposal?

Abstract:
   Segment routing uses globally-known labels to accomplish destination-
   based forwarding along shortest paths computed using Dijkstra's
   algorithm with IGP metrics.  This draft discusses how to use segment
   routing to accomplish destination-based forwarding along paths
   computed using other algorithms and metrics.  In particular, the
   draft contrasts two different options for associating labels with
   different algorithms for computing forwarding next-hops.
